Joseph Melillo Middle School
Joseph Melillo Middle School is a school in Town of East Haven, South Central Connecticut Planning Region, Connecticut which is located on Hudson Street. Joseph Melillo Middle School is situated nearby to the school East Haven Academy, as well as near the suburb The Annex.| Tap on a place to explore it |
- Type: School
- Also known as: “East Haven Middle School”
- Address: 67 Hudson Street, East Haven, CT 06512

Shore Line Trolley Museum
Museum
Photo: Versageek, CC BY-SA 3.0.
The Shore Line Trolley Museum is a trolley museum located in East Haven, Connecticut. Incorporated in 1945, it is the oldest continuously operating trolley museum in the United States. Shore Line Trolley Museum is situated 1 mile south of Joseph Melillo Middle School.
East Haven Green Historic District
Park
Photo: Dep369, CC BY-SA 3.0.
The East Haven Green is the town green of the New England town of East Haven, Connecticut. It is bounded by River Street, Hemingway Avenue, Main Street, and Park Place and is the focal point of the East Haven Green Historic District, listed on the National Register of Historic Places. East Haven Green Historic District is situated 4,000 feet south of Joseph Melillo Middle School.

The Annex
Suburb
The Annex is a residential neighborhood in the city of New Haven, Connecticut. Originally part of East Haven, the neighborhood was voluntarily ceded by East Haven and annexed by the city of New Haven in the 1880s.
